Avatar

AlexTZ

AlexTZ

Подробная информация

Имя пользователя
AlexTZ
Присоединился
Посещений
0
Был на сайте
Группы
FR Team

Комментарии

  • Будет много переделок, в том числе и в интерфейсе. Запишу себе в todo. Быстро не обещаю, т.к. сейчас есть более приоритетные задачи.
  • Алгоритм разреза такой, ничего не поделаешь. Если страница пользовательского формата, но соответствует А3 по размерам - все работает как положено. Если чуть больше или меньше (в пределах сантиметра) - будут проблемы с подбором подходящей ориентации.
  • Здравствуйте, Проверил печать на MS Office Document Image Writer, все в порядке - А4 в портрете. На реальном принтере проверю завтра. Над новым режимом подумаю, но не обещаю. Мне уже видятся некоторые проблемы в реализации.
  • Порядок полей в источнике не совпадал с порядком в отчете. Поправил.
  • Ошибку повторил, буду разбираться.
  • Не могу понять, в чем дело. У всех баркодов в готовом отчете текст пустой. Хотя рядом лежит объект "Текст", подключенный к тому же полю, и там все в порядке. Попробуйте удалить источник данных, сохранить отчет, открыть отчет и добавить источник данн…
  • Ваш отчет у меня работает без ошибок. Пришлите файл .fpx готового отчета, в котором есть ошибка.
  • Да, символика code128 поддерживает только ascii-символы. Русские буквы случайно не пытаетесь печатать?
  • Пришлите, пожалуйста, файл .fpx, посмотрю.
  • Проверил. Все работает как в Вашем отчете, так и в моих, тестовых. Работает в обоих случаях - когда последняя строка данных переносится на новую страницу, и когда не переносится.
  • Config.ReportSettings.ShowProgress? или в компоненте EnvironmentSettings (что в toolbox)
    Раздел: Вопросы по Fastreport.net Комментарий от AlexTZ November 2008
  • Здравствуйте, Конечно, могу. Для начала пришлите скриншот?
  • Show внутри использует Prepare, проблемы быть не должно: if (!report.IsRunning) report.Show(); Такую проверку надо делать при любых действиях с report, пока он строится. В демке так же сделано, проблем не вижу.
  • Переделал так, чтобы флаг взводился при входе в Prepare.
  • Надо делать проверку: if (!report1.IsRunning) report1.Prepare();
  • Частично проблему можно решить с помощью св-в Underlines и LineSpacing объекта "Текст". Однако в таком варианте сложно выставить высоту строки = 0.5см. Я, наверное, вместо св-ва LineSpacing сделаю LineHeight.
    Раздел: Документация (user Manual) Комментарий от AlexTZ November 2008
  • Да, атрибуты обрабатываются неверно... Исправил, но в сегодняшний билд уже не успеет попасть.
  • Ссылки на родителя поправил. По поводу второго вопроса - попробовал на своих объектах - нормально. Как выглядит TestItem?
  • Картинки - сегодня в полночь По поводу дерева: пробовал регистрировать такой бизнес-объект, работает нормально:     class MyTreeNode     {       private IList FNodes;       public IList Nodes       {         get { return FNodes; }       }   …
  • Almaz написал: » 4) при редактировании стиля в дезайнере для рамки не сохраняется цвет и толщина (т.е. зашли, отредактировали, нажали ок, еще раз зашли - цвет снова черный, толщина 1). Делаю так и все работает: - захожу в редактор стилей ("О…
  • написал: » 1. Добавляем в отчет датасорсы (у меня их 3) и параметры. 2. Из Visual Studio вызываем "Select Data Source..." 3. В окне жмем кнопу "<<", т.е. удалить все и сразу. 4. Сохраняем 5. Открываем редактор отчета, игнорируя окно выбо…
  • Такое может быть, если при регистрации датасета Вы используете разные имена, т.е. первоначально вызвали report.RegisterData(myDataSet, "my_dataset"); а потом имя поменяли: report.RegisterData(myDataSet, "MyDataSet"); Проверьте содержимое файла .…
    Раздел: Работа с Dataset Комментарий от AlexTZ November 2008
  • Здравствуйте, 1) это баг, буду исправлять. 2) сразу нельзя. Задать алиасы можно в окне "Данные", сделать это нужно один раз. 3) если дерево слишком сложное, это возможно. В этом случае ограничьте уровень вложенности при регистрации данных в отч…
  • Попробовал и так - параметры не удаляются, да и не должны. Можете описать пошагово?
  • Проверяю на демке. Для этого поправил руками файл nwind.xml: поле Employees.ReportsTo переименовал в ReportsTo1. В результате в отчете поля ReportsTo не видно, зато есть ReportsTo1. Насчет параметров не понял. Добавляю параметр отчета, добавляю дат…
  • Спасибо, поправил. Скриншоты и перевод интерфейса делались после того, как был написан текст.
    Раздел: Документация (user Manual) Комментарий от AlexTZ November 2008
  • Здравствуйте, На вашем рисунке - это две ячейки контрола "Таблица"?
    Раздел: Документация (user Manual) Комментарий от AlexTZ November 2008
  • Кстати, что из антивирусов у Вас стоит? Я так и не смог повторить ситуацию у себя. Возможно, что такое поведение связано с работой антивируса (проверка сертификата, если он есть, перед запуском).
  • Если в датасорс вносились изменения, достаточно зайти в окно "Данные|Выбрать данные для отчета..." и включить колонки, которые были добавлены (они по умолчанию невидимы).
  • Мы отключили подписывание сертификатом от verisign, попробуйте на следующей сборке (должна быть готова после полуночи).